The Introductions 

On a January day in Graiguenamanagh, we had the pleasure of welcoming Hannah, Daniel, and their family for a tour of the mill. That Saturday, the mill was alive with energy and curiosity. Miriam guided our visitors through each stage of the process, from the carding machine and looms to the washroom and warp, before finishing at our cherished spinning mule. Along the way, Miriam shared stories of the past and the rhythms of mill life today.

A favourite moment was seeing the children gather around Philip’s nearly 80-year-old baby shoe (5th generation). Their genuine fascination with our history, heritage, and craftsmanship was a joy to witness.

The Making Of 

Soon after their visit, the creative process began; exploring design options, colours, and feel to craft a bespoke Irish blanket: The Ballerina Farm Blanket. Hannah and Daniel fell in love with our bespoke Rowan Green, aptly named after the green leaves of the Rowan Tree, indigenous to Ireland. What better colour to capture their memories of Ireland? From dyeing, warping and weaving to washing and final quality checks, this throw is crafted to the high quality standards we maintain.
